What is Zentangle?

Zentangle is an empowering art form developed by Rick Roberts and Maria Thomas. Artists use basic strokes and simple steps (called “The Zentangle Method”) to create complex, non-representational art. At the core of the Zentangle method is the philosophy of “no mistakes.” As the art is abstract and not predetermined, artists are encouraged to turn ‘oops’ into opportunity.

The motto of Zentangle is ‘everything is possible, one step at a time’. Students frequently express doubt in their ability to create art as beautiful as the examples they have seen.  However, by using the Zentangle Method, and following the Eight Steps, they do create their own, uniquely beautiful works of art.  The result of practicing Zentangle is striking: improved morale, self-confidence and mental health,.

About Certified Zentangle Teachers (CZTs)

Certified Zentangle Teacher (CST) is a practitioner of the Zentangle Method who can teach students tangles and the Zentangle Method. To teach classes, a potential teacher must take the extensive training course offered by Zentangle HQ. This course ensures the teacher is familiar with not only the art and techniques used in Tangling but also deeply understands the principles and philosophy of the practice.
